次の方法で共有


XmlSyntaxException コンストラクター

定義

XmlSyntaxException クラスの新しいインスタンスを初期化します。

オーバーロード

XmlSyntaxException()

XmlSyntaxException クラスの新しいインスタンスを、既定のプロパティを使用して初期化します。

XmlSyntaxException(Int32)

XmlSyntaxException クラスの新しいインスタンスを、例外が検出された行番号を使用して初期化します。

XmlSyntaxException(String)

指定したエラー メッセージを使用して、XmlSyntaxException クラスの新しいインスタンスを初期化します。

XmlSyntaxException(Int32, String)

XmlSyntaxException クラスの新しいインスタンスを、指定したエラー メッセージと例外が検出された行番号を使用して初期化します。

XmlSyntaxException(String, Exception)

指定したエラー メッセージおよびこの例外の原因となった内部例外への参照を使用して、XmlSyntaxException クラスの新しいインスタンスを初期化します。

XmlSyntaxException()

ソース:
XmlSyntaxException.cs
ソース:
XmlSyntaxException.cs
ソース:
XmlSyntaxException.cs
ソース:
XmlSyntaxException.cs

XmlSyntaxException クラスの新しいインスタンスを、既定のプロパティを使用して初期化します。

public:
 XmlSyntaxException();
public XmlSyntaxException ();
Public Sub New ()

注釈

次の表に、XmlSyntaxException のインスタンスに対するプロパティの初期値を示します。

プロパティ
InnerException null.
Message "構文が無効です。"

適用対象

XmlSyntaxException(Int32)

ソース:
XmlSyntaxException.cs
ソース:
XmlSyntaxException.cs
ソース:
XmlSyntaxException.cs
ソース:
XmlSyntaxException.cs

XmlSyntaxException クラスの新しいインスタンスを、例外が検出された行番号を使用して初期化します。

public:
 XmlSyntaxException(int lineNumber);
public XmlSyntaxException (int lineNumber);
new System.Security.XmlSyntaxException : int -> System.Security.XmlSyntaxException
Public Sub New (lineNumber As Integer)

パラメーター

lineNumber
Int32

XML 構文エラーが検出された XML ストリームの行番号。

注釈

改行文字が検出されるたびに、XML ストリームの行番号が更新されます。 番号付けは、最初の行の 1 から始まります。

次の表に、XmlSyntaxException のインスタンスに対するプロパティの初期値を示します。

プロパティ
InnerException null.
Message "行 lineNumberの構文が無効です。

適用対象

XmlSyntaxException(String)

ソース:
XmlSyntaxException.cs
ソース:
XmlSyntaxException.cs
ソース:
XmlSyntaxException.cs
ソース:
XmlSyntaxException.cs

指定したエラー メッセージを使用して、XmlSyntaxException クラスの新しいインスタンスを初期化します。

public:
 XmlSyntaxException(System::String ^ message);
public XmlSyntaxException (string message);
new System.Security.XmlSyntaxException : string -> System.Security.XmlSyntaxException
Public Sub New (message As String)

パラメーター

message
String

例外の原因を説明するエラー メッセージ。

注釈

次の表に、XmlSyntaxException のインスタンスに対するプロパティの初期値を示します。

プロパティ
InnerException null.
Message エラー メッセージ文字列。

適用対象

XmlSyntaxException(Int32, String)

ソース:
XmlSyntaxException.cs
ソース:
XmlSyntaxException.cs
ソース:
XmlSyntaxException.cs
ソース:
XmlSyntaxException.cs

XmlSyntaxException クラスの新しいインスタンスを、指定したエラー メッセージと例外が検出された行番号を使用して初期化します。

public:
 XmlSyntaxException(int lineNumber, System::String ^ message);
public XmlSyntaxException (int lineNumber, string message);
new System.Security.XmlSyntaxException : int * string -> System.Security.XmlSyntaxException
Public Sub New (lineNumber As Integer, message As String)

パラメーター

lineNumber
Int32

XML 構文エラーが検出された XML ストリームの行番号。

message
String

例外の原因を説明するエラー メッセージ。

注釈

改行文字が検出されるたびに、XML ストリームの行番号が更新されます。 番号付けは、最初の行の 1 から始まります。

次の表に、XmlSyntaxException のインスタンスに対するプロパティの初期値を示します。

プロパティ
InnerException null.
Message "行 lineNumber - message の構文が無効です"

適用対象

XmlSyntaxException(String, Exception)

ソース:
XmlSyntaxException.cs
ソース:
XmlSyntaxException.cs
ソース:
XmlSyntaxException.cs
ソース:
XmlSyntaxException.cs

指定したエラー メッセージおよびこの例外の原因となった内部例外への参照を使用して、XmlSyntaxException クラスの新しいインスタンスを初期化します。

public:
 XmlSyntaxException(System::String ^ message, Exception ^ inner);
public XmlSyntaxException (string message, Exception inner);
new System.Security.XmlSyntaxException : string * Exception -> System.Security.XmlSyntaxException
Public Sub New (message As String, inner As Exception)

パラメーター

message
String

例外の原因を説明するエラー メッセージ。

inner
Exception

現在の例外の原因となった例外。 inner パラメーターが null でない場合は、内部例外を処理する catch ブロックで現在の例外が発生します。

注釈

前の例外の直接の結果としてスローされる例外については、InnerException プロパティに、前の例外への参照を含める必要があります。 InnerException プロパティは、コンストラクターに渡されるのと同じ値を返します。または、InnerException プロパティがコンストラクターに内部例外値を提供しない場合には null を返します。

次の表に、XmlSyntaxException のインスタンスに対するプロパティの初期値を示します。

プロパティ [値]
InnerException 内部例外の参照。
Message エラー メッセージ文字列。

こちらもご覧ください

適用対象